Comparable Facts
Compare Bob Jones University in Greenville, SC with Denver College of Nursing in Denver, CO on tuition, admissions, graduation, earnings, and student body data using the table above.
Bob Jones University is larger than Denver College of Nursing based on total student enrollment (2,734 students vs. 811 students)
Location, institution type, and student-faculty ratio
- Bob Jones University is located in Greenville, SC (Small City setting); Denver College of Nursing is in Denver, CO (Large City setting).
- Bob Jones University is a private, for-profit 4-year institution. Denver College of Nursing is a private, for-profit 4-year institution.
- Student-to-faculty ratio: Bob Jones University 11:1; Denver College of Nursing 13:1.
Bob Jones University vs. Denver College of Nursing Cost Comparison
Which college is more expensive, Bob Jones University or Denver College of Nursing?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).
-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Denver College of Nursing are 8.5% lower than at Bob Jones University ($9,495 vs. $10,380).
- Bob Jones University is 47.8% more expensive for in-state tuition than Denver College of Nursing (about $7,913 more per year; $24,470.00 vs. $16,557.00).
- Out-of-state tuition is 47.8% higher at Bob Jones University than at Denver College of Nursing (about $7,913 more per year; $24,470.00 vs. $16,557.00).
- A larger share of students receive grant aid at Bob Jones University than at Denver College of Nursing (93% vs. 0%).

Bob Jones University vs. Denver College of Nursing Graduation Outcomes Comparison
How do outcomes compare for Bob Jones University and Denver College of Nursing?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).
- Among federal student loan borrowers, Bob Jones University graduates have a $8,263 lower median loan debt than Denver College of Nursing graduates ($19,000 vs. $27,263).
- Among borrowers, Bob Jones University graduates have an estimated $85 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than Denver College of Nursing graduates ($196 vs. $281).
- More Bob Jones University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Denver College of Nursing students, three years after graduation. (83% vs. 76%)
